What are the key technical specifications to consider when selecting a mining blower for underground ventilation?
When sourcing mining blowers, the primary focus should be on Air Volume (m³/min) and Static Pressure (Pa) to ensure the ventilation system can overcome the resistance of long-distance tunnels. You must prioritize Explosion-proof Motors (Ex d I Mb or Ex d IIB T4) to ensure safety in environments with methane or coal dust. Additionally, look for impellers made of anti-static and flame-retardant materials (such as carbon steel with specialized coatings or reinforced plastics) to prevent spark generation.
Which international compliance standards are mandatory for mining ventilation equipment?
For global trade, the equipment must adhere to rigorous safety certifications. Ensure the supplier provides ATEX (Europe) or IECEx (International) certification for explosive atmospheres. For the Chinese market and many Belt and Road regions, the MA (Mining Product Safety Approval Mark) is essential. Furthermore, verify that the noise levels comply with ISO 3744 standards, as excessive noise in confined mining spaces can lead to occupational health hazards.
How does the choice between axial flow and centrifugal blowers impact mining operations?
Axial flow blowers are generally preferred for underground mining due to their compact design, high efficiency, and ease of installation in narrow tunnels. They are ideal for moving large volumes of air. Centrifugal blowers, while bulkier, are better suited for high-pressure applications where air needs to be pushed through complex filtration systems or very long ducting. For most B2B buyers, counter-rotating axial fans offer the best balance of energy efficiency and pressure output.
What maintenance features should a high-quality mining blower include?
To minimize downtime, select blowers equipped with online vibration monitoring sensors and bearing temperature sensors. These allow for predictive maintenance. Ensure the design allows for easy access to the motor and blades without dismantling the entire ventilation duct. Suppliers offering IP55 or IP65 rated enclosures will ensure the internal components are protected against the high humidity and dust typical of mining environments.

How can I mitigate the risks of purchasing heavy industrial machinery from overseas suppliers?
Utilize Third-Party Inspection services (such as SGS or Bureau Veritas) to conduct a pre-shipment inspection (PSI). This ensures the blower's performance curves, insulation resistance, and explosion-proof seals meet the agreed-upon specifications before the final payment is released. What are the best practices for negotiating lead times and shipping for bulky mining blowers?
Mining blowers are often 'made-to-order.' Negotiate a staged payment plan (e.g., 30% deposit, 40% after production/testing, 30% after inspection) to maintain leverage. For shipping, use FOB (Free On Board) to maintain control over the freight costs and insurance, as these units are heavy and require specialized sea freight packaging (seaworthy wooden crates with vacuum moisture-proof bags) to prevent corrosion during transit.

How do international trade policies and customs duties affect the import of mining blowers?
Check the HS Code (typically 8414.59) for your specific country to determine import tariffs. Be aware of Anti-Dumping Duties that may apply to steel products in certain regions. Ensure the supplier provides a Certificate of Origin (CO), such as Form E or Form RCEP, which can significantly reduce or exempt you from import duties under various Free Trade Agreements.
